How much do you need to earn to live in Wellington? We calculate the gross monthly salary required to cover rent, food, transport, and utilities — accounting for New Zealand's tax system.
You need at least $4,060/month gross to live in Wellington on a budget.
For a comfortable lifestyle, aim for $4,931/month gross ($3,870 net after ~19% tax).
| Expense | Budget | Comfortable | Premium |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rent (1BR) | $1,900 Cheapest neighborhood (Petone) | $2,350 Median neighborhood | $2,600 Premium neighborhood (Kelburn) |
| Groceries | $550 | $660 | $825 |
| Transport | $225 | $225 | $225 |
| Utilities | $275 | $275 | $275 |
| Dining & Entertainment | $300 | $360 | $450 |
| Total Monthly Expenses | $3,250 | $3,870 | $4,375 |
$4,060/month gross
$4,931/month gross
$5,705/month gross

Open calculatorWe total monthly expenses (rent, groceries, transport, utilities, dining out) for each lifestyle tier, then reverse-calculate the gross salary needed to cover those expenses after New Zealand's income tax and social contributions. Rent data comes from second-hand market listings (what expats actually pay). All figures are based on 2026 data from official government statistics. See our data sources for full attribution.
On a budget lifestyle, you need at least $4,060/month gross salary to cover basic expenses in Wellington. For a comfortable lifestyle, aim for $4,931/month gross. These figures include rent, food, transport, utilities, and dining out, with taxes calculated for New Zealand.
The average 1-bedroom rent across 7 neighborhoods in Wellington is approximately $2,321/month. Rents range from $1,900 in Petone to $2,800 in Kelburn.
Monthly groceries for a single person in Wellington cost approximately $550. This covers basic home cooking. Dining out and premium food will add to this budget.
Tax rates in New Zealand are progressive. At the budget salary level of $4,060/month, the effective tax rate is approximately 17%. At the comfortable level of $4,931/month, it rises to approximately 19%. This includes income tax and social contributions.
